Abstract :
This paper proposes a new, energy efficient medium access control (MAC) protocol for wireless sensor networks. Wireless sensor networks consist of thousands of simple nodes. Energy efficiency is primary goal in wireless sensor networks. The new protocol is suitable for low-power consumption while latency is less important. The new protocol called DMDS-MAC which is based on distributed mediation device (DMD) protocol and S-MAC protocol utilizes listening/sleep duty cycle mechanism. And it uses mediation device to synchronize the neighbor nodes temporarily. Then they can communicate each other successfully. This can decrease the cost of the nodes
